About This Vintage 1955 Edition

"Onions in the Stew" by Betty MacDonald, published by J. B. Lippincott Company in 1955, offers a humorous and insightful look into life on Vashon Island. Known for her wit and engaging storytelling, MacDonald shares her experiences with characteristic charm. This edition, published in Philadelphia and New York, is a hardcover format, reflecting the mid-20th-century publishing standards. The book is an ex-library copy, indicating its journey through public circulation, and retains its original dust jacket despite noticeable wear. While the first edition status is unspecified, this copy provides a glimpse into MacDonald's life and the Pacific Northwest during that era.
